Senior Engineering Manager - Talent

The Talent Engineering team supports Wayfair Global Talent and is responsible for developing and maintaining an ecosystem of technologies and processes that helps find, hire, and inspire the most diverse and talented individuals as a differentiator for our business. We create fluid and holistic end-to-end experiences for every Wayfarian to be productive in their role, bring their true and best self to work, and develop confidently towards their future. Tools created by the team are essential for Wayfair’s entire talent lifecycle, including headcount planning, talent acquisition and onboarding, and internal mobility.

What You'll Do

  • Grow, manage, and develop a team of 8-10 engineers
  • Be responsible for owning features developed by your team in each phase of a project: design, implementation, code review, QA and deployment to production
  • Seek out, define, and evolve best practices within teams’ area of focus as well as initiatives that raise the standards across the organization
  • Partner directly with your product and design counterparts to define the strategy of your product suite and build the roadmap for your team
  • Develop and maintain relationships with key stakeholders in the Talent organization
  • Work with a variety of technologies, including PHP, Python, Java, React, Kafka, GraphQL, Docker, Kubernetes, and GCP

What You'll Need

  • 3-5 years experience of managing a team of up to 10 engineers
  • Track record as both an individual contributor and a manager of delivering strong business outcomes
  • A minimum of a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science or related field
  • Experience making architectural and design-related decisions, understanding the tradeoffs between time-to-market vs. flexibility
  • Excellent communication skills and ability to work effectively with engineers, product managers, designers and business stakeholders
  • Passion for building high performing engineering teams
